As they continue to shake up the online publishing world, Wattpad announced the addition of OMERS Ventures to its online community for discovering and sharing stories. OMERS joins existing Khosla Ventures of San Francisco, Union Square Ventures of New York and Golden Venture Partners of Toronto.
“We see this as the ideal trifecta, having world-class investment partners from Silicon Valley, New York and Toronto,” said Wattpad CEO Allen Lau. “OMERS Ventures and our other investors will be true partners in our vision for building a company that will transform the publishing ecosystem.”
“It’s astonishing when you grasp the ability Wattpad has to fundamentally transform the very nature of a book by adding a real time, mobile social dynamic to the storytelling process. We’re not only excited to be an investor, we’re also extremely proud that this homegrown Canadian company has such a huge global following and growth prospects,” said Howard Gwin, Managing Director of OMERS Ventures.
With their rapid pace of grown, Wattpad will use the funds to expand its team and bring in new talent through hiring and acquisitions. They will also focus on product enhancements and expanding their community.
So far for the month of September 2012, the total number of stories posted online topped the 6 million mark, with 900,000 new stories now being uploaded every month. Wattpad has 10 million monthly unique users, and the number of minutes spent on the site has more than doubled in just six months to 2.4 billion in August.
